Additionally, the 3D effect in Avatar just wasn't that pronounced. It was a lot more subtle than most; kudos to James Cameron for not just throwing stuff at the screen all the time. I'm actually picking up on details watching it in 2D that I didn't notice in 3D, likely because of how 3D is really just a trick achieved by having to put glasses on. That said, they're obviously milking it by releasing this thing now. Hell, it's still showing in cinemas out here (no doubt because the seats are still filling up). I don't think a release now was warranted, and that thing you said about buying on a whim and getting pissed when they release better versions down the track, I can totally relate to that. It's still a fantastic Blu-Ray, the quality is unparalleled. I don't care about the additional 6 minutes, so I won't be heading back into the theatres to see it again, and sometime next year when I've finally been able to afford a 3D screen of my own, I'll be happy to then go and pick up the 3D Blu Ray of this one. |
